Output 43b0c72e8d4026255e102b6fd98486b9539f218cb7ab4f1b156beb423cd23ede:1

value
287863183
script pubkey
OP_0 OP_PUSHBYTES_20 d6909815f3e21f0511d112d876dc60faa055945e
address
bc1q66gfs90nug0s2yw3ztv8dhrql2s9t9z70fl52p
transaction
43b0c72e8d4026255e102b6fd98486b9539f218cb7ab4f1b156beb423cd23ede
spent
true